For traders with enough capital to get by on 4:1 leverage (or 6:1 if you can qualify for Portfolio Margin accounts), you could bypass the new test altogether and open a retail account. The only downside is the leverage factor. Otherwise the benefits are: * 100% payout (since the entire balance of the account belongs to you). * SIPC protection * no testing or continuing education For some traders, the leverage is key, but if you are not capital-intensive, retail might be the way to go.
